Jamaican footballer Allan Cole, considered a legend by these conversant in his aptitude on and off the ball, was a trusted confidant and highway supervisor of Reggae King Robert Nesta Marley.
‘Talent,’ as he was affectionately referred to as by associates, had two Jamaican loves, particularly music and soccer. On the soccer area, Cole dazzled everybody together with his aptitude and phenomenal expertise, incomes recognition as one of many most interesting strikers ever to signify the island. As his good friend, Cole assisted Marley in navigating the rocky roads within the music trade.
“Allan ‘Talent’ Cole was Bob’s mentor, idol, and confidant,” journalist and reggae historian Stan Smith informed Caribbean Nationwide Weekly.
“Bob was drawn to the youthful Talent Cole due to his worldwide fame as a footballer and his bodily self-discipline as an athlete. In music, the self-discipline and success Allan exercised in managing the Wailers’ highly effective, conflicting, and competing skills and artistic personalities had been spectacular. His eager ear and consciousness made them Rastafarian brothers,” Smith opined.

Cole and Marley’s friendship started within the Sixties, when Cole was a younger soccer star and Marley was constructing his music profession as a aware reggae singer. Each carried the hopes of Jamaica — Cole being the soccer genius, whereas Marley together with his guitar.
“Bob and I shared a philosophy of resilience,” Cole as soon as stated. “We pushed one another, and we carried Jamaica all over the place we went.”
For Marley, soccer was an escape, whereas for Cole it was a strategy to preserve his good friend grounded. Their relationship blossomed on the daybreak of the Seventies, when Jamaica was caught within the crosswinds of the treacherous Chilly Conflict. The then U.S. administration in Washington by no means embraced Michael Manley’s socialist ideology. It was throughout this era that Cole took on the pivotal function as Marley’s supervisor, serving to to information him by means of the politically charged period. Marley’s life was not with out peril. This was on show within the wake of the 1976 assassination try on Marley’s life at his 56 Hope Street dwelling in Kingston. By all of it, Cole was shut at hand.
Smith shared, “In music, the self-discipline and success Allan exercised in managing the Wailers’ highly effective, conflicting, and competing skills and artistic personalities was spectacular. Allan’s eager ear and consciousness made them Rastafarian brothers.”
In truth, when Marley recorded Exodus and Kaya in exile, Cole supplied companionship and stability, reminding the singer of dwelling. And when Marley returned to Jamaica to carry out on the historic 1978 One Love Peace Live performance on the Nationwide Stadium in Kingston that united political rivals Michael Manley and Edward Seaga onstage, Cole was there by his aspect.
“I’m the one man he stated he couldn’t pay again,” Cole stated in an interview in Jamaica. Their bond was constructed not on contracts, however on loyalty. That loyalty additionally gave Cole an perception into Marley’s non-public life.
Cole reportedly was current for Marley’s marriage to Rita Anderson. He additionally had firsthand information of Marley’s high-profile relationship with Cindy Breakspeare, the Miss World winner in 1976. Cole noticed firsthand the extreme public scrutiny that got here with Marley’s fame. Years after Marley’s dying, he lamented the portrayal of Marley within the current biopic Bob Marley: One Love, which he stated neglected vital truths.
“I used to be the closest particular person to him, and I do know his historical past greater than anybody else,” he informed Anthony Miller in a TVJ interview. “Issues we shared, no one else is aware of.”

‘Talent’ Cole’s dying marked the top of an period in Jamaica. Marley and Cole commanded the world’s consideration, collectively embodying the pleasure and resilience of a nation in search of to seek out its rhythm.
As certainly one of Jamaica’s most gifted footballers, Talent Cole helped elevate the game domestically and internationally, and his function as Bob Marley’s supervisor positioned him on the coronary heart of a worldwide cultural revolution that fused music, sport, and id.
